Q: Is 261,146,655 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 261,146,655 is a composite number.

Why is 261,146,655 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 261,146,655 can be evenly divided by 1 3 5 7 9 11 15 21 33 35 45 55 63 77 99 105 165 231 315 385 495 693 1,155 3,465 75,367 226,101 376,835 527,569 678,303 829,037 1,130,505 1,582,707 2,487,111 2,637,845 3,391,515 4,145,185 4,748,121 5,803,259 7,461,333 7,913,535 12,435,555 17,409,777 23,740,605 29,016,295 37,306,665 52,229,331 87,048,885 and 261,146,655, with no remainder.

Since 261,146,655 cannot be divided by just 1 and 261,146,655, it is a composite number.
